是否可以/支持使用 Java 进行 Impala 查询?

Posted

技术标签:

【中文标题】是否可以/支持使用 Java 进行 Impala 查询?【英文标题】:Is it possible/supported to do an Impala query with Java? 【发布时间】:2013-08-07 18:32:02 【问题描述】:

我想在 Java 中对 HBase 表运行 impala 查询。我找不到办法做到这一点。

任何人都可以将我指向正确的方向,指向库或示例或任何我可以运行查询并获得结果的地方吗?

我已经尝试使用 jsch 在服务器上运行命令,但不幸的是这给了我一些问题(没有输出出现)。

【问题讨论】:

【参考方案1】:

我还没有真正使用它,但看起来https://github.com/pauldeschacht/impala-java-client 可能会满足您的需求

【讨论】:

看起来会很完美。我在测试它时遇到了一些问题(主要是无效的方法名称),但我会继续研究它!谢谢。我不认为你知道任何地方的 api?【参考方案2】:

Cloudera 提供 Impala JDBC 连接器,请查看 docs。

【讨论】:

以上是关于是否可以/支持使用 Java 进行 Impala 查询?的主要内容,如果未能解决你的问题,请参考以下文章

Google Dataproc 是不是支持 Apache Impala?

impala 实操

Impala 不支持 Unicode 字符

Cloudera impala 支持 mongodb 吗?

impala 理论

是否可以在 Hadoop 1 中使用 Impala(没有 YARN)?